a bit more progress to report I added the following line to my boinc startup file export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=${LD_LIBRARY_PATH}:.:$BOINC_PATH/projects/www.gpugrid.net This on a GTX295 running Fedora 9. It has just now completed its first WUs since upgrading the drivers to 185.18.14. I'll try the same trick on the 2 machines still failing |

I am running Suse 11.2 Milestone 4 with the beta 190 driver. The fix/workaround for Gpugrid and BOINC works and is stable. I had to delete the old work and settings and reset the project to get it to move forward. If you have any remnants of the old work units or settings, you will need to detach or reset to get rid of them. Detach may be better since it erases the old files. Good luck. |
